The Maserati Ghibli is a luxury executive sedan that combines Italian design flair with dynamic driving performance. Introduced originally in the late 1960s as a grand tourer, the Ghibli name was revived in 2013 with a modern four-door sedan that blends sports car agility with luxury comfort. Across its generations, the Ghibli has evolved in size and technology, featuring sleek dimensions suited for both city and grand touring use. Maserati’s focus on elegant styling and powerful engine options ensures the Ghibli remains a distinctive choice in the luxury sedan segment.
